Dormansland is a timeworn English village in Surrey found in the district of Tandridge. It is located 22 miles south of London and encapsulates the traditional English countryside.

Buying and renting in Dormansland

Average house prices in Dormansland hover around £680,000, while rental properties range from £1,200 to £2,000 per month, depending on the type and size of the property.

Public transportation in Dormansland

Dormansland isn’t served by a train station itself, but Dormans and Lingfield stations are only a short drive away, providing regular trains to London. Gatwick Airport is conveniently located 9 miles away, offering global connectivity.
